What problem does it solve?

This Skill provides detailed guidance on how to fine-tune and customize web services built with InterSystems IRIS, enabling developers to control various aspects of their behavior, security, and WSDL generation.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• WSDL Control: Manage WSDL accessibility, namespace declarations, and type definitions.
  • Security & Authentication: Configure username/password requirements and control access.
  • Message Formatting: Customize SOAP envelope prefixes, message names, and element qualification.
  • Error Handling & Callbacks: Implement custom processing, error handling, and callbacks for request/response management.
  • Use Case: A developer needs to expose an existing InterSystems IRIS business logic as a SOAP web service. They can use this Skill to configure the service to disable WSDL access, enforce authentication, and ensure the generated WSDL accurately reflects the expected data types and namespaces.

Quick Start

Configure your InterSystems IRIS web service to disable online WSDL access by setting the SOAPDISABLEWSDL parameter to 1.
